Paperwhite Narcissus bloom time is Early Spring and Spring whereas Japanese Camellia bloom time is Early Spring and Late Winter.

The pH of soil can be of three types: Alkaline, Acidic and Neutral. Paperwhite Narcissus and Japanese Camellia pH of soil is as follows:

  • Paperwhite Narcissus p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line
  • Japanese Camellia p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ral
